However, the bulk of nerve supply from C5and 6 is transported to the shoulder joint by just two nerves, the … WebThe fascia iliaca nerve block is a large-volume nerve block. Its success depends on the spread of local anesthetic underneath the fascia iliaca. A volume of 30–40 mL of injectate is necessary to accomplish the nerve block. The spread of local anesthetic is monitored with ultrasonography. Web1 de mar. de 2016 · The most common type of nerve block performed is a forearm nerve block (ulnar, median, or radial). The most common indication for US-guided nerve blocks is fracture pain management. Only 7% (95% CI, 2%–12%) of programs have a separate credentialing pathway for US-guided nerve blocks.
